在数字化时代,数据库成为了存储和管理数据的核心。对于许多开发者和个人用户来说,拥有一个稳定、高效且易于管理的数据库至关重要。本文将向您介绍如何在阿里云服务器上轻松搭建自己的数据库,确保您的数据得到妥善保管。
第一步:选择合适的云服务器
访问阿里云官网并注册账号后,您需要根据自身业务需求挑选适合的ECS(Elastic Compute Service)实例类型。考虑因素包括计算能力、内存大小、磁盘空间以及网络带宽等。一旦确定了配置,请按照页面提示完成购买流程。
第二步:安装操作系统及环境准备
购买完成后,在控制台中启动新创建的ECS实例,并为其安装所需的操作系统。通常推荐使用Linux发行版如Ubuntu或CentOS作为数据库服务器的基础平台。接下来,通过SSH远程登录到您的服务器,并更新系统软件包以保证安全性和兼容性:
sudo apt update && sudo apt upgrade -y 对于基于Debian的系统
sudo yum update -y 对于基于Red Hat的系统
第三步:部署数据库服务
阿里云支持多种类型的数据库解决方案,这里我们以MySQL为例来说明如何部署。首先安装MySQL服务器:
sudo apt install mysql-server Ubuntu/Debian
sudo yum install mysql-server CentOS/RHEL
然后运行安全脚本来设置root密码,并禁用一些不安全的默认设置:
sudo mysql_secure_installation
第四步:配置防火墙规则
为确保数据库能够被合法地访问,需调整防火墙策略允许特定端口上的流量通行。例如,MySQL默认监听3306端口:
sudo ufw allow 3306/tcp Ubuntu
sudo firewall-cmd --permanent --add-port=3306/tcp CentOS
sudo systemctl restart firewalld 重启防火墙使更改生效
第五步:优化性能与备份策略
为了提高数据库的响应速度和服务稳定性,可以根据实际工作负载调整MySQL的相关参数。同时制定定期备份计划,以防数据丢失。可以利用mysqldump命令行工具执行全量或增量备份操作。
通过上述步骤,您现在已经掌握了如何在阿里云ECS实例上快速搭建起一个功能齐全的数据库环境。随着技术不断进步,建议持续关注官方文档和技术社区中的最新动态,以便随时掌握最佳实践方法。
别忘了,在开始任何购买之前先领取『阿里云优惠券』,这样可以在购买阿里云产品时享受额外折扣哦!。
本文由阿里云优惠网发布。发布者:编辑员。禁止采集与转载行为,违者必究。出处:https://aliyunyh.com/374839.html
其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。